The Ultimate Guide to Driving from Amherst, New Hampshire to Wrentham, Massachusetts

Are you planning a road trip from Amherst, New Hampshire to Wrentham, Massachusetts? If so, it’s important to know the different routes, distances, and travel times, especially with the potential for traffic. In this post, we’ll provide you with all the information you need to plan your journey, whether you’re looking for the fastest or most scenic route.

The Fastest Route: via I-495 South

If you’re looking for the fastest way to get to Wrentham, Massachusetts from Amherst, NH, the best route is via I-495 South. This route covers a distance of approximately 89 miles and typically takes around 1 hour and 40 minutes to complete, assuming normal traffic conditions. During peak traffic, however, the travel time can increase by up to 30 minutes.

The Scenic Route: via Route 146 South

If you prefer a more scenic drive, consider Route 146 South. This route is slightly longer, covering a distance of approximately 93 miles, but it is well worth it for those who enjoy beautiful natural landscapes. The travel time from Amherst to Wrentham via Route 146 South is typically around 2 hours, but, again, during peak traffic times, it can take up to an extra 30 minutes.

Slower Routes: via MA-122 and MA-140

There are a few slower routes to consider if you want to take your time and enjoy the scenery. One such route is via MA-122 and MA-140, which covers a distance of approximately 100 miles. This route will take you through beautiful towns like Uxbridge and Milford, but the travel time is longer, typically taking around 2 and a half to 3 hours.
